Output 9509fa7aa16bb83f75d029badb8e4584563322b51790d75d0c5ea9a2d323614f:0

value
18577085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7625decec3a5d0b454f189600b1375a4c1b5bcf OP_EQUAL
address
MQcojBo7D5v5ybXGGb3mQCTRav8p8H6y7i
transaction
9509fa7aa16bb83f75d029badb8e4584563322b51790d75d0c5ea9a2d323614f
spent
true